About Koorana

Koorana's vision is tocreate and support learning and social opportunities in caring environments for all children and young people.

We are a not-for-profit children's organisation, working with children and young people 0-18 years of all abilities. Our services include:

  • High-quality early childhood education to 160 children a week - 25% of these places are reserved for children with disabilities and high learning support needs;
  • Early intervention and allied health support to over 300 families a year;
  • Family support services including playgroups to over 1,400 families a year across Sydney.

Koorana employs over 65 staff and has a turnover of approximately $6.5 million per annum.

Koorana values self-determination, universal access and equity, mutual respect, collaboration, ethicalbehaviour,and integrity. Our practice is driven by family-centred principles and evidence-based best practice, fostering natural community inclusion and quality management through the key worker model. Our services are designed to ensure that families are well-informed, have choices, and are supported in their decisions.

The Board's focus is on strategically building individual and collective capability and performance, developing new products, services and affiliate partner channels. The Board seeks to expand our community impact and reach new families by growing services which support all children and families. Koorana operates out of our Head Office in Belmore and our satellite office in Miranda and provides services to children over a large geographic footprint including Sydney's inner west, south-west and the Sutherland shire.
